SIOUX CITY, Iowa (KTIV) -
The driver of an SUV involved in a fatal crash has pleaded not guilty to vehicular homicide.
18-year-old Oscar Ramirez entered the plea Friday in Woodbury County District Court. A trial date is not yet set.
He was the driver of a sport-utility vehicle that crashed on Jan. 30. The vehicle rolled several times and landed in a pasture.
Eighteen-year-old Nino Segura of Sioux City was thrown from the vehicle and pronounced dead at the scene.
